Abstract

As the innovation age encourages individuals to communicate their emotions via web-based media locales like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, and so on. Numerous individuals share their musings and thoughts step by step in twitter similar to other tweets. This is considered as an exciting and attractive way to express ourselves as inspections are increasing bit by bit, due to which rundown of surveys are necessary for the job where summed up of text is required to give helpful data from the huge number of surveys. It is exceptionally hard for an individual to extricate helpful information or sum up it from the extremely enormous record. This paper focuses on comparison and analysis of different sentiment analysis techniques. It gives a far-reaching review about the recent and past examinations on sentiment analysis, challenges, and approaches for future angles.
